We traveled to Atlanta, GA. to see Dr. Sinervo at the Center For Endometriosis Care. Previous surgeons could never figure out what was going on and as I was only getting worse we thought it was time to go to the best of the best to find some answers regarding my GYN pains and issues, as well as find some relief. In this video, my fiancé gets very detailed with explaining how surgery went, what they found and what they needed to remove.
Ended up needing to have my uterus, cervix, left ovary, fallopian tubes and appendix taken out. All they could save was my right ovary (thankfully, so that I will still be able to get hormones I need). Also they found Endometriosis all over and did excision.
